Nearby venues and attractions add to the experience: The Ray Theatre and Library Center Theatre host Sundance screenings and screenings-related events; Deer Valley’s Snow Park Outdoor Amphitheater brings the Utah Symphony and big-name acts to the resort summer circuit; Canyons Village’s Concerts on the Slopes offer a rotating lineup of artists, and Park City Live on Main Street is a staple for headline performances. Don’t miss Park Silly Sunday Market along Main Street for live music, local vendors, and a vibrant summer scene. For multi-venue festivals, Park City Song Summit showcases performances across City Park Stage, Library Field, Jim Santy Auditorium, and The Marquis. Ready to plan your Park City experience?
